Analysis

Panama recorded 471 1000 USD for ecuador — forest products (export/import) — export value in 2018.

The figure is up 22.0% on the previous year and down 42.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, ecuador — forest products (export/import) — export value in Panama peaked at 1,554 1000 USD in 2015 and was at its lowest, 27 1000 USD, in 2004.

Panama ranks 35th of 53 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
